About Us

The Community Living Society (CLS) is an innovative non-profit organization which since 1978 has been dedicated to supporting adults with intellectual and developmental disabilities so that they can live full, productive and meaningful lives. We are leaders in providing quality Person Centered support through our residential, individualized and community based supports so that people can reach their greatest potential. We have over 500 employees and work with over 400 individuals throughout the Lower Mainland.

About the Opportunity

We are actively seeking an innovative, energetic and creative Manager's of Home Share. Reporting to a Director of Director of Programs, the Manager of Home Share will work closely with the supported individuals and teams to provide an environment of support that is focused on supporting the individuals to live as independently as possible. The Manager of Home Share is accountable for the day to day management of the Home Share Provider's locations and relief pool. This role primarily administrative; direct supports may be required from time-to-time.

The Manager of Home Share provides direct coaching and support to a group of Home Share Coordinators. Managers are considered to be professionals, leaders and part of the CLS management team. CLS will require from time to time, movement to an alternate geographic program/location within the organization to facilitate transfer of knowledge and staff development. This position is accountable to actively work with the Administration team including other Director(s), as assigned.

General Duties:

  • Oversight of multiple locations, ensuring effective and smooth operation of the location, including emergency preparedness
  • Engaging and supporting individuals to live as full citizens
  • Provide leadership to Home Share Providers to ensure the effective support of the Supported Individuals in all areas of decision making, informed choices, goal achievement and safety and security, while respecting the values, customs, and beliefs of the individual.
  • Selecting, onboarding, training and the development of these Home Share Coordinators.
  • General administration including scheduling, timecard approvals, budgeting, and financial accountabilities for all the locations and individuals within the designated locations
  • General administration and reporting related to the support of the individuals.
  • Maintaining strong and supportive relationships with all the supported individual networks, members of the public, family members and team members.
  • Act as primary contact for CLBC Analysts for referrals and queries.
